高浓活性污泥法处理印染废水的研究  被引量:7

Preliminary Study on High Concentration of Activated Sludge Treatment of Dying-printing Wastewater

摘  要:介绍了在不同污泥浓度条件下处理印染废水的实验。实验表明,在一定污泥浓度范围内(2500~6500mg/L),增加污泥浓度对印染废水的污染物去除效率和处理深度都有较明显的提高。当废水进水COD在750 mg/L左右,MLSS约为6 g/L时,出水COD能达到100mg/L以下,COD去除率在80%以上。但经过不同污泥浓度的好氧处理后,色度并未有明显变化,说明好氧法活性污泥法对色度去除效果有限。相对低浓法,镜检观察到高浓法活性污泥中的原后生动物数量和种类更多,表明污泥更加成熟,水质情况更佳。The experiment of dying-printing wastewater treatment at several sludge concentration factors is introduced.In a range of concentrations(2500~6500mg/L),the experiment research shows that the removal rate and degree of Dying-printing Wastewater treatment is obviously improved as increasing the Concentration of Sludge.When the inflow COD(Chemical Oxygen Demand)and MLSS(Mixed Liquor Suspended Solids)are about 750 mg/L and 6g/L respectively,effluent with COD<100 mg/L is obtained and the COD removal increases more than 80%.But after aerobic treatment with different sludge concentration.The Chromaticity change is not obvious.It shows that aerobic activated sludge method has limited effect on color removal.Compare the Process of Low concentration activated sludge,A greater number and variety of proto-or metazoans were observed in highly enriched activated sludge By microscopy.This show that the sludge is more mature and the water quality is better.
